Twin Oaks Reservoir Tank No. 2

IEC is currently performing construction management and inspection services for the Twin Oaks Reservoir No. 2, soon to be the largest pre-stressed concrete tank in the world. When complete, the tank will be 40 feet high with an inside diameter of 432 feet making the total capacity 40 million gallons. The tank will include 249 miles of pre-stressed wrapping strand, 22,950 CY of concrete, and 575,000 pounds of steel. The project will be constructed in three phases: mass grading, reservoir construction and final site improvements. When the third phase is complete, the reservoir will be completely buried and landscaped, concealing it from the surrounding community. In combination with the Twin Oaks Reservoir No. 1, an existing 33 MG tank on the same site, this project will complete the ultimate master plan for storage facilities on the Twin Oaks site, having an overall water storage capacity of 73 MG.

• Maximized use of site to allow construction of largest tank possible

• Negotiated construction cost for the tank

• Developed 3 separate sets of construction documents to reduce the overall schedule
